How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 77469?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 77469 Studio Apartments | $1,156 | $979 | $1,492 |
| 77469 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,376 | $482 | $5,626 |
| 77469 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,781 | $695 | $7,451 |
| 77469 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,193 | $1,175 | $8,063 |
| 77469 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,100 | $4,100 | $4,100 |
